General tips when making videos

like Sean said, know your audience that will be viewing the video before making it. There are a few different types

Wrap up Video for own team/chiefdelphiers - little explanation of FIRST needed, the audience already knows. Fast paced music with lots of quick clips of highlights. This is where your video did great in, especially when combining with pictures. The main purpose you may want to stress are pictures of people instead of parts of the robot, you mostly did well here too.

Many of the videos were great, but could use a little more editing, show the best parts of each, don't start them too early or end late. Remember music can be edited as well to fit your video better. Wildstangs 2004 encore video is a great example to putting your video to music.


Recruitment videos
- Very similar, but a further explanation of what FIRST is. When people first join robotics, they want to see battlebots, give them the video of defensive play just to satisfy the bloodlust for the moment, show and explain the high energy sportlike competitions.

Parents - Include scholarship opportunities, working with engineers, and hands on experience.

Sponsors- Don't forget close up shots of the robot and T-shirts with other sponsors on them! mention travel and how many people/teams/other companies will be at those competitions.

Administration/school board - Again, scholarship opportunities, other schools that participate, travel opportunity, real world experience, and most importantly how it can improve test scores and inspire math, science, and technology in students. for Florida, mention how it can improve the FCAT
